September is Library Card Sign Up Month

Visit the Lemont Public Library to sign up for a free card this month and enter a drawing for Chicago Bears-themed prizes.

Library Director Sandra Pointon encourages all residents of the Lemont Public Library District to sign up for a free library card.

A library card offers patrons a world of education, exploration and entertainment, Pointon said. Books, free programs for all ages, ebooks and ereaders, audiobooks, electronic databases, computer classes, and free Internet access are among the variety of resources open to residents at their library.

“If you don’t have a library card yet, now is the time to get one,” said Pointon. “It’s a great deal, especially during September, which is Library Card Sign-up Month.”

Anyone who receives a new library card or renews his or her card in September will be entered into a drawing for Chicago Bears-themed prizes for kids, teens and adults.

Signing up for a library card is easy and free. Bring proof of residency in the Lemont Public Library District (driver’s license with current address or utility bill) to the Circulation Desk at 50 E. Wend Street, Lemont, to apply for a card today.
